Different types of RV overhangs serve different purposes. Window and door overhangs provide shade over the windows or entry doors of a recreational vehicle. Slide out overhangs keep water and debris away from the slide out roof, while patio overhangs provide shade when a person wants to sit and enjoy the outdoors.

Overhang fabrics are usually made from vinyl or acrylic. Some of these structures have an aluminum or vinyl wrap around weather guard that serves the role of protecting the fabric when the awning is in travel position. Inspecting the fabric of an awning for signs of stains and mildew after it is stored for a long duration is essential. Mildew can grow on vinyl overhangs. If they find that the fabric is clean, RV owners can wash it normally using mild soap, water and a soft brush.

When cleaning an awning, you should not use abrasive or oil based cleaners. Clean the structure thoroughly on both sides and rinse it. If the overhang is affected by mildew or is stained, you can use after market commercial cleaners designed to clean awning fabrics. As you clean the overhang fabric, you should also inspect it for excessive wear or tear.

When you are using an overhang, inspect its metallic structure. The bottom overhang brackets support most of the weight of the overhang. Check to see that the overhang brackets are tight. You should also inspect the arm pivot holes to find out if the handles have broken rivets or enlarged holes. It is also important inspect the roller tube. Check if it is warped after you roll the overhang out.

Before they utilize RV awnings California RV owners should repair any damaged or broken parts. RV owners should also make sure that the rails of awnings are securely mounted on the side of their RVs. They should make sure that someone is always nearby when the awning is rolled out to prevent wind damage. RV owners should also ensure that their awnings are insured.
